fork(1) download
  1. #include <bits/stdc++.h>
  2. int main() {
  3. int p = 0, q = 0;
  4. for (int i = 1; i <= 52; i++) {
  5. for (int j = 1; j <= 52; j++) {
  6. if (i == j) { continue; }
  7. for (int k = 1; k <= 52; k++) {
  8. if (k == i || k == j) { continue; }
  9. for (int t = 1; t <= 52; t++) {
  10. if (t == i || t == j || t == k) { continue; }
  11. for (int l = 1; l <= 52; l++) {
  12. if (l == t || l == k || l == i || l == j) { continue; }
  13. int res = !(i % 13)+!(j % 13)+!(k % 13)+!(t % 13)+!(l % 13);
  14. p += res;
  15. q++;
  16. }
  17. }
  18. }
  19. }
  20. }
  21. std::cout << "answer for 5 cards is "
  22. << p / std::__gcd(p,q) << "/"
  23. << q / std::__gcd(p,q) << std::endl;
  24. return 0;
  25. }
Success #stdin #stdout 0.79s 15232KB
stdin
Standard input is empty
stdout
answer for 5 cards is 5/13